Additive manufacturing, also known as 3D printing, has been making significant strides in recent years One of the most innovative techniques within this field is Laser Powder Bed Fusion (LPBF) additive manufacturing LPBF additive manufacturing involves using a high-powered laser to selectively melt and fuse powdered materials, layer by layer, to create intricate and complex three-dimensional objects This cutting-edge technology has revolutionized the manufacturing industry, offering numerous benefits and advantages over traditional manufacturing methods.

Despite its numerous advantages, LPBF additive manufacturing is not without its challenges Issues such as porosity, residual stress, and dimensional accuracy can arise during the manufacturing process, requiring careful monitoring and optimization of parameters to achieve desired results Additionally, the high cost of equipment and materials, as well as the need for specialized training and expertise, can present barriers to entry for some manufacturers looking to adopt this technology.
